Mulberry Confirms Exotic Skins Ban!

Following years of urging by PETA UK – and as conservation experts warn that the trade in exotic skins risks fuelling the spread of diseases like COVID-19 – luxury fashion brand Mulberry has confirmed a ban on exotic skins in all its future collections.
The spring/summer 2020 season marks the brand’s first-ever departure from using the skins of alligators, crocodiles, ostriches, lizards, or snakes in its designs. Mulberry already has a fur-free policy.
